Consistent performance on heat‑resistant alloys

The PVD‑coated carbide composition of this insert, specified as AH8015, is designed as a first choice for the general machining of heat‑resistant alloys. The coating layer improves surface resistance to temperature and wear while the substrate maintains edge stability, which together reduce unplanned tool changes and support a steady production rhythm. The combination of coating and substrate produces a compromise between wear resistance and toughness that suits a wide range of turning operations without sacrificing component quality.

Reliable ISO compatibility and secure clamping

Configured to the ISO 120404 format, the insert fits into ISO‑standard holders where compatibility depends on form, relief angle, tolerance class, fastening and thickness. The rhombic profile and 80° geometry deliver predictable cutting vectors, while the cylindrical hole and 0° relief angle ensure repeatable seating and clamping. Specifying the correct holder and clamping kit is essential for optimal performance; matched systems reduce vibration and improve surface finish during both external and internal turning.

Economical tool life and controlled chip formation

The insert is double‑sided with an integrated chipbreaker to promote controlled chip formation in a variety of feeds and depths of cut. Using both cutting edges extends the effective service life per insert and improves cost efficiency in batch production. For stable machining, select the chipbreaker and grade appropriate to the workpiece material and the machining strategy. Dimensions / Core data

  • Inscribed circle (IC): 12 mm

  • Plate thickness: 4.76 mm

  • Corner radius: 0.4 mm

  • Relief angle: 0°

  • Main angle: 80°

  • Hole: cylindrical hole

Special features

  • Material: carbide (Hartmetall)

  • Coating: PVD

  • Shape: rhombic

  • Chipbreaker: double‑sided

  • Application: turning (external and internal), suitable for heat‑resistant alloys

  • Compatibility: ISO‑standard holders — fit determined by form, relief angle, tolerance class, fastening, size and thickness

FAQ

Which materials is this insert intended for?
The AH8015 grade is primarily specified for the general machining of heat‑resistant alloys; the insert’s PVD‑coated carbide construction provides a balance of wear resistance and edge toughness suitable for such applications.

How is compatibility with toolholders ensured?
Compatibility relies on ISO‑standard geometry: the CNMG 120404 form, the 80° main angle, 0° relief and the plate thickness must match the holder’s seating, fastening and tolerance class.

What are the key geometric values to check before assembly?
Check the inscribed circle (12 mm), plate thickness (4.76 mm), corner radius (0.4 mm) and the presence of the cylindrical hole; these values determine correct seating and clamp engagement.

What coating and substrate does this insert use?
The insert is a PVD‑coated carbide in grade AH8015, combining a wear‑resistant coating with a robust carbide substrate for balanced cutting performance.

How does the chipbreaker support machining?
The double‑sided chipbreaker promotes predictable chip control across a range of feeds and depths, aiding surface finish and reducing the risk of entangling chips during turning operations.
